I would have some rubber in your surface, if you can, I wish I had included a percentage although I have s. sand and fibre, as on its own, it gets deep in dry weather - the wet is great, Good luck!

Agree re rubber, but use the small chips not the big strips of rubber, as having used both the long strips tend to create a trip hazard, as well as not insulating the sand against freezing as much.
